Runbook bit: Tindergrove EXIF scrubber. Quick context for review — the scrubber pulls uploads off the Mossway queue, strips metadata, and writes clean copies back. If you see originals leaking through, it's almost always the worker failing auth and falling back to passthrough (yes, we know, fix pending). Check the env file on the worker box; it needs to have this line in it.

vault entry, yahif-yajep: COURIER_KEY29=b802bdf8034096b65a51c6ba5abe2

## Tuning the nightly reindex

Heads up, support folks: the Pellermist search reindex runs after midnight and occasionally lags if the catalog grew a lot that day. Before escalating to the Driftwell crew, check whether the job just needs a wider batch window. Most slowdowns trace back to one of the knobs below, so start there.

limits module of kawef-hawef:
TIERS = {
    "belax": 967,
    "gorvan": 210,
    "ulair": 473,
}

Hi Marek — handing over the batch of calibration weights from the Veltrin Metrology lab today. Twelve pieces total, 1 g up to 2 kg, all in the grey foam case with the tamper seals still intact. They were last verified on the Drossel comparator, so don't open the case until your clean bench is ready. Humidity log is taped inside the lid. The courier from Quickhart Freight will bring them to your dock at Norrfeld around midday. Before release, the driver must quote the following phrase:

courier memo of yawep-yafog: the pramir ulaix courier leaves the ulavan aldix frair zorok oliiel joreth rusdor fenvan ledger at gate 1305 under passcode 514738

# Fixture for the Twigsweep stale-branch cleanup bot.
# These fake branches mimic the weird cases we demoed at eng sync:
# branches with open drafts, ones pinned by the release crew, and one
# that's 400 days old but protected. The bot should skip all three.
# Running the fixture against the Hollowfen test org needs auth, so
# the harness reads the token below.

session JWT of yawep-yawep = eyJhbGciOiJIUzI1NiIsInR5cCI6IkpXVCJ9.eyJzdWIiOiI3pWF3_In0.aXYsHiog